Semantic Browsing: Controllable Diversity for Image Generation
A technique for controllable diversity in text-to-image generation by inducing structured semantic variations at the prompt level via VLM and agentic workflow.
-
Analysis-by-Proxy: Localization Signals in VLMs Operating as Condition Encoders
A lightweight Q-Former proxy trained on VLM hidden states reveals that localization signals peak in input-dependent intermediate layers, not the final layers used by standard editing pipelines.
-
ReflectCAP: Detailed Image Captioning with Reflective Memory
ReflectCAP distills model-specific hallucination and oversight patterns into Structured Reflection Notes that steer LVLMs toward more factual and complete image captions, reaching the Pareto frontier on factuality-coverage trade-offs.
-
Scaling Mixture-of-Experts Video Pretraining for Embodied Intelligence
LingBot-Video is an open-source MoE video foundation model for embodied intelligence that scales to 120B parameters, integrates robot data, and uses multi-dimensional RL to improve physical plausibility.
-
APE: Agentic Prompt Enhancer for Image Generation and Editing
APE post-trains small language models as single-agent or multi-agent prompt enhancers that improve visual alignment on image generation and editing benchmarks without altering the downstream visual model.
-
LTX-2: Efficient Joint Audio-Visual Foundation Model
LTX-2 generates high-quality synchronized audiovisual content from text prompts via an asymmetric 14B-video / 5B-audio dual-stream transformer with cross-attention and modality-aware guidance.
-
Token-to-Token Alignment of Text Embeddings for Semantic Blending
Token-to-Token alignment rephrases prompts into shared structure then matches token embeddings by semantic similarity, making linear interpolation a meaningful operation for blending in text-to-image models.
